The Symbolism of Pearls

Dream Of Pearls

Before we dive into the meaning of pearl dreams, let’s take a moment to understand the symbolism behind these precious gems. Pearls are often associated with the following qualities:

  • Purity and Innocence: Pearls are white and luminous, representing purity, innocence, and spiritual transformation.
  • Wisdom and Integrity: The process of creating a pearl requires time, patience, and resilience, symbolizing the wisdom gained through life experiences.
  • Femininity and Fertility: Pearls are often linked to the moon, water, and the feminine energy of creation and fertility.
  • Wealth and Success: As a highly valued gem, pearls are often seen as a symbol of wealth, success, and social status.

Understanding the symbolism of pearls can help you better interpret the meaning of your pearl dreams.

Common Pearl Dream Interpretations

Dream Of Pearls

1. Dreaming of Wearing Pearls

If you dream of wearing pearls, it may signify that you are embracing your femininity, grace, and inner wisdom. This dream may also indicate that you are entering a phase of personal growth and self-discovery. Wearing pearls in a dream can also be a sign of your desire for sophistication and elegance in your waking life.

2. Dreaming of Receiving Pearls as a Gift

Receiving pearls as a gift in your dream may represent the love, appreciation, and respect you receive from others. It could also signify that someone is offering you valuable advice or guidance. Alternatively, this dream may be a sign that you are ready to accept the gifts and blessings that life has to offer.

3. Dreaming of Losing Pearls

If you dream of losing pearls, it may indicate a sense of loss or fear of losing something valuable in your waking life. This could be a relationship, a job opportunity, or a cherished possession. Losing pearls in a dream may also represent a loss of innocence or purity.

4. Dreaming of Finding Pearls

Dreaming of finding pearls is often a positive sign, indicating that you are discovering hidden talents, inner strength, or new opportunities. This dream may also suggest that you are uncovering the truth about a situation or relationship in your waking life.

5. Dreaming of a Pearl Necklace Breaking

If you dream of a pearl necklace breaking, it may symbolize a sense of disconnection or a breakdown in communication with someone close to you. This dream may also indicate that you are feeling overwhelmed by the demands and expectations placed upon you.

Pearls and Their Colors in Dreams

Dream Of Pearls

The color of the pearls in your dream can also hold significant meaning. Here are some common interpretations based on pearl color:

  • White Pearls: White pearls often represent purity, innocence, and new beginnings. Dreaming of white pearls may indicate a fresh start or a clean slate in your waking life.
  • Black Pearls: Black pearls are rare and mysterious, often associated with independence, strength, and protection. Dreaming of black pearls may signify a need for self-reflection and introspection.
  • Pink Pearls: Pink pearls are linked to love, romance, and femininity. Dreaming of pink pearls may indicate a blossoming romance or a need for self-love and care.
  • Golden Pearls: Golden pearls symbolize wealth, prosperity, and success. Dreaming of golden pearls may be a sign that you are on the path to achieving your goals and desires.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are pearl dreams more common for women?

While pearls are often associated with femininity, pearl dreams can be experienced by anyone, regardless of gender. The interpretation of the dream may vary based on the individual’s personal experiences and emotions.

What if I dream of fake or imitation pearls?

Dreaming of fake or imitation pearls may suggest that something in your waking life is not as it seems. It could be a sign that you are surrounded by insincerity or that someone is being dishonest with you.

Can the size of the pearls in my dream hold significance?

Yes, the size of the pearls in your dream can offer additional insight. Large pearls may represent significant opportunities or achievements, while small pearls may symbolize minor challenges or everyday blessings.

What if I dream of giving pearls to someone else?

Dreaming of giving pearls to someone else may indicate that you are offering support, love, or guidance to that person. It could also signify your desire to share your wisdom and experiences with others.
